How Can You Effectively Implement Water Conservation During Pet Baths?

Effective Techniques to Minimise Water Usage
Begin your journey towards water conservation during pet baths by adopting straightforward yet effective techniques that can significantly reduce water consumption. One of the initial steps involves tracking your pet's bathing sessions using a timer. Setting a timer for 10-15 minutes fosters awareness of water usage, preventing lengthy bathing sessions that often lead to excessive water waste.
Another effective method is to select appropriate bathing tools that reduce water waste. For example, using a handheld sprayer with adjustable flow settings allows you to control water pressure according to your pet's size and coat type. Alternatively, rinsing with a bucket can considerably decrease water usage compared to traditional hose methods. Filling a bucket for rinsing instead of allowing a hose to run continuously can save significant gallons of water with every bath.
Additionally, considering the water temperature is crucial for both comfort and conservation. Warm water enhances cleaning effectiveness, permitting shorter bathing durations while ensuring your pet remains comfortable. Finally, opt for eco-friendly shampoos and conditioners that require less rinsing, effectively saving further water while being gentle on your pet's skin.
Vital Tools for Enhancing Water Conservation Practices
Equipping yourself with the appropriate tools can make water conservation during pet baths an effortless aspect of your routine. Various devices can assist in measuring and controlling water flow, empowering pet owners to make informed adjustments. One such tool is a water flow meter, which can be installed into your indoor or outdoor plumbing systems. These meters offer real-time insights into water usage, enabling pet owners to modify their habits based on actual consumption.
Specialised bathing sprayers designed for pets often feature low-flow technology. These sprayers facilitate efficient rinsing while utilising significantly less water than standard hose attachments. Another valuable tool is a shower timer, which helps restrict bathing duration and guides users to adhere to their water-saving objectives.
Investing in a quality grooming brush can also play a pivotal role in water conservation. An effective brush removes excess dirt and debris before bathing, potentially reducing the need for extensive rinsing. Frequently Asked Questions about Water Conservation in Pet Baths
What are some simple ways to conserve water during pet baths?
Some straightforward methods include timing bath sessions, utilising a bucket for rinsing, and selecting water-efficient bathing tools. Additionally, consider using a spray nozzle to more effectively control water flow.
How does water conservation benefit my pet's health?
Conserving water during baths prevents over-wetting, reducing the risk of skin infections and irritation. This approach promotes better overall hygiene for your pet.
What tools can assist with water conservation during pet baths?
Tools such as low-flow sprayers, water flow meters, and shower timers can aid in monitoring and limiting water usage during pet baths, making conservation more manageable.
Why is it important to track water usage in pet baths?
Tracking water usage helps identify areas for improvement and encourages accountability. Regular evaluation ensures long-term success in conservation efforts.
Can saving water lead to cost reductions in pet care?
Yes, conserving water can lower utility bills and reduce the need for frequent purchases of grooming products, contributing to overall savings in pet care expenses.
How often should I bathe my pet to conserve water?
Bathing frequency depends on your pet's coat type and activity level. Many pets only require a bath every few weeks or months, allowing for reduced water usage.
What eco-friendly products should I use for pet baths?
Opt for biodegradable shampoos and conditioners that require less rinsing, minimising water waste while ensuring your pet remains clean and healthy.
